Worship of Lord Dhanvantari
Lord Dhanvantari Puja: Dhanteras is also called Dhantrayodashi, which is celebrated on the Trayodashi date of Krishna Paksha of Kartik month. The five-day festival of Diwali begins from the day of Dhanteras. According to the Hindu calendar, Dhanteras will be celebrated on 18 October 2025. Lord Dhanvantari, Goddess Lakshmi and Lord Kuber are mainly worshiped on this day. Let us tell you who is Lord Dhanvantari and why is he worshiped on Dhanteras.
Who is Lord Dhanvantari?
Lord Dhanvantari is considered to be the incarnation of Lord Vishnu. He appeared with the pot of nectar during the churning of the ocean, who is the father of Ayurveda and the physician of the gods. Lord Dhanvantari is seen as a radiant form appearing during the churning of the ocean holding a pot of nectar in his hand. The four-armed Dhanvantari holds nectar pot, conch, chakra and herbs or medicine in his hands.
Why is Lord Dhanvantari worshipped?
Lord Dhanvantari is worshiped on Dhanteras because on this day he appeared during the churning of the ocean. Lord Dhanvantari is worshiped on Dhanteras for good health, longevity and freedom from diseases. This worship of Lord Dhanvantari goes along with the worship of Lakshmi, the goddess of wealth and prosperity, and Kuber, the god of wealth, which fulfills the wishes of good health as well as financial gain.
Birth of Lord Dhanvantari
According to mythology, on the Trayodashi date of Krishna Paksha of Kartik month, during the churning of the ocean, Dhanvantari Dev appeared from the Kshir Sagar carrying the nectar pot. For this reason, worshiping Dhanvantari Dev and buying gold and silver on the day of Dhanteras is considered very auspicious. In such a situation, Dhanteras is also celebrated as the birth anniversary of Lord Dhanvantari.
blessings of health and prosperity
The day of Dhanteras is also celebrated as ‘Dhanvantari Jayanti’ and ‘Ayurveda Day’, because health is considered the greatest wealth. By worshiping Lord Dhanvantari, people get freedom from physical and mental troubles and get the blessings of good health. Lord Dhanvantari is worshiped for health and longevity. At the same time, on Dhanteras, Goddess Lakshmi is worshiped for wealth and prosperity. Also, on Dhanteras, Kuber Dev is worshiped as the god of wealth.
